[111965] trunk/dports/multimedia/libvpx
devans at macports.org
devans at macports.org
Sun Oct 6 19:38:00 PDT 2013
Revision: 111965
https://trac.macports.org/changeset/111965
Author: devans at macports.org
Date: 2013-10-06 19:38:00 -0700 (Sun, 06 Oct 2013)
Log Message:
-----------
libvpx: update to version 1.2.0, remove upstream patch now included.
Modified Paths:
--------------
trunk/dports/multimedia/libvpx/Portfile
trunk/dports/multimedia/libvpx/files/configure.patch
trunk/dports/multimedia/libvpx/files/patch-build-make-configure.sh.diff
Removed Paths:
-------------
trunk/dports/multimedia/libvpx/files/patch-build-make-gen_asm_deps.sh.diff
Modified: trunk/dports/multimedia/libvpx/Portfile
===================================================================
--- trunk/dports/multimedia/libvpx/Portfile 2013-10-06 22:07:13 UTC (rev 111964)
+++ trunk/dports/multimedia/libvpx/Portfile 2013-10-07 02:38:00 UTC (rev 111965)
@@ -5,7 +5,7 @@
PortGroup muniversal 1.0
name libvpx
-version 1.1.0
+version 1.2.0
categories multimedia
maintainers nomaintainer
platforms darwin
@@ -19,8 +19,8 @@
use_bzip2 yes
distname ${name}-v${version}
-checksums rmd160 6f462c1421a51af77d3401ea4c1eaf0dbeaf4791 \
- sha256 9ce074cf4b3bcd9a49ff93e05485b71c273bfc3685a305e55a0e7fa51beb72c5
+checksums rmd160 ed43d99dd4a0166baf9caca7a50841ced695eb08 \
+ sha256 9993d0db15c4c37838c2584123d18ae5de39e76875a4c6c27458ae378e9a327c
depends_build port:yasm
@@ -30,8 +30,6 @@
# Use the correct SDK
patchfiles-append configure.patch
-# patch for mountain lion compatibility, see https://gerrit.chromium.org/gerrit/#change,26027 for upstream
-patchfiles-append patch-build-make-gen_asm_deps.sh.diff
# As of 0.9.1: doesn't handle shared libraries or debug properly on darwin;
# doesn't install docs or examples correctly, so disable them.
Modified: trunk/dports/multimedia/libvpx/files/configure.patch
===================================================================
--- trunk/dports/multimedia/libvpx/files/configure.patch 2013-10-06 22:07:13 UTC (rev 111964)
+++ trunk/dports/multimedia/libvpx/files/configure.patch 2013-10-07 02:38:00 UTC (rev 111965)
@@ -1,6 +1,6 @@
---- build/make/configure.sh.orig 2012-12-31 12:39:09.000000000 -0800
-+++ build/make/configure.sh 2012-12-31 12:41:25.000000000 -0800
-@@ -572,25 +572,13 @@ process_common_toolchain() {
+--- build/make/configure.sh.orig 2013-10-06 19:07:09.000000000 -0700
++++ build/make/configure.sh 2013-10-06 19:07:09.000000000 -0700
+@@ -621,25 +621,13 @@
# detect tgt_os
case "$gcctarget" in
@@ -30,7 +30,7 @@
;;
*mingw32*|*cygwin*)
[ -z "$tgt_isa" ] && tgt_isa=x86
-@@ -640,55 +628,6 @@ process_common_toolchain() {
+@@ -689,55 +677,6 @@
# PIC is probably what we want when building shared libs
enabled shared && soft_enable pic
@@ -86,9 +86,9 @@
# Handle Solaris variants. Solaris 10 needs -lposix4
case ${toolchain} in
sparc-solaris-*)
---- configure.orig 2012-12-31 12:41:43.000000000 -0800
-+++ configure 2012-12-31 12:43:33.000000000 -0800
-@@ -99,9 +99,11 @@ all_platforms="${all_platforms} armv7-no
+--- configure.orig 2013-09-04 11:49:22.000000000 -0700
++++ configure 2013-10-06 19:07:09.000000000 -0700
+@@ -100,9 +100,11 @@
all_platforms="${all_platforms} mips32-linux-gcc"
all_platforms="${all_platforms} ppc32-darwin8-gcc"
all_platforms="${all_platforms} ppc32-darwin9-gcc"
@@ -100,7 +100,7 @@
all_platforms="${all_platforms} ppc64-linux-gcc"
all_platforms="${all_platforms} sparc-solaris-gcc"
all_platforms="${all_platforms} x86-darwin8-gcc"
-@@ -111,6 +113,8 @@ all_platforms="${all_platforms} x86-darw
+@@ -112,6 +114,8 @@
all_platforms="${all_platforms} x86-darwin10-gcc"
all_platforms="${all_platforms} x86-darwin11-gcc"
all_platforms="${all_platforms} x86-darwin12-gcc"
@@ -109,7 +109,7 @@
all_platforms="${all_platforms} x86-linux-gcc"
all_platforms="${all_platforms} x86-linux-icc"
all_platforms="${all_platforms} x86-os2-gcc"
-@@ -123,6 +127,8 @@ all_platforms="${all_platforms} x86_64-d
+@@ -124,6 +128,8 @@
all_platforms="${all_platforms} x86_64-darwin10-gcc"
all_platforms="${all_platforms} x86_64-darwin11-gcc"
all_platforms="${all_platforms} x86_64-darwin12-gcc"
@@ -118,7 +118,7 @@
all_platforms="${all_platforms} x86_64-linux-gcc"
all_platforms="${all_platforms} x86_64-linux-icc"
all_platforms="${all_platforms} x86_64-solaris-gcc"
-@@ -134,6 +140,8 @@ all_platforms="${all_platforms} universa
+@@ -135,6 +141,8 @@
all_platforms="${all_platforms} universal-darwin10-gcc"
all_platforms="${all_platforms} universal-darwin11-gcc"
all_platforms="${all_platforms} universal-darwin12-gcc"
Modified: trunk/dports/multimedia/libvpx/files/patch-build-make-configure.sh.diff
===================================================================
--- trunk/dports/multimedia/libvpx/files/patch-build-make-configure.sh.diff 2013-10-06 22:07:13 UTC (rev 111964)
+++ trunk/dports/multimedia/libvpx/files/patch-build-make-configure.sh.diff 2013-10-07 02:38:00 UTC (rev 111965)
@@ -1,6 +1,6 @@
---- build/make/configure.sh.orig 2012-01-27 10:36:39.000000000 -0800
-+++ build/make/configure.sh 2012-02-17 09:40:29.000000000 -0800
-@@ -394,10 +394,10 @@ AS_SFX = ${AS_SFX:-.asm}
+--- build/make/configure.sh.orig 2013-09-04 11:49:22.000000000 -0700
++++ build/make/configure.sh 2013-10-06 19:00:20.000000000 -0700
+@@ -435,10 +435,10 @@
EOF
if enabled rvct; then cat >> $1 << EOF
Deleted: trunk/dports/multimedia/libvpx/files/patch-build-make-gen_asm_deps.sh.diff
===================================================================
--- trunk/dports/multimedia/libvpx/files/patch-build-make-gen_asm_deps.sh.diff 2013-10-06 22:07:13 UTC (rev 111964)
+++ trunk/dports/multimedia/libvpx/files/patch-build-make-gen_asm_deps.sh.diff 2013-10-07 02:38:00 UTC (rev 111965)
@@ -1,11 +0,0 @@
---- build/make/gen_asm_deps.sh.orig 2012-07-18 23:43:18.000000000 +0200
-+++ build/make/gen_asm_deps.sh 2012-07-18 23:45:52.000000000 +0200
-@@ -42,7 +42,7 @@
-
- [ -n "$srcfile" ] || show_help
- sfx=${sfx:-asm}
--includes=$(LC_ALL=C egrep -i "include +\"?+[a-z0-9_/]+\.${sfx}" $srcfile |
-+includes=$(LC_ALL=C egrep -i "include +\"?[a-z0-9_/]+\.${sfx}" $srcfile |
- perl -p -e "s;.*?([a-z0-9_/]+.${sfx}).*;\1;")
- #" restore editor state
- for inc in ${includes}; do
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.macosforge.org/pipermail/macports-changes/attachments/20131006/fcdb633c/attachment-0001.html>
More information about the macports-changes
mailing list